Ir para conteúdo

[ALPHA!] SIMPLEMACHINES


Manolo8

Posts Recomendados

É um plugin independente de máquinas... Já vem com máquinas (Só precisa do vault pra funcionar...)

Então ele e um plugin de maquinas ? com /maquinas combustiveis essas coisas configuravel ? ,o video ta OFF pra min deve ser minha net acho 

Link para o comentário
Compartilhar em outros sites

Então ele e um plugin de maquinas ? com /maquinas combustiveis essas coisas configuravel ? ,o video ta OFF pra min deve ser minha net acho 

 

Tem um link em baixo do vídeo que funfa...

 

Ele é um plugin de máquinas multibloco. Você pode comprar um livro (que é um plano de construção)

No livro você vai ter as informações dos materiais nescessários para construir a máquina.

Ai é só clicar em um bloco de ferro com os materiais que a construção irá começar...

Ai nas outras páginas do livro você pode ver o que sua máquina pode fazer...

(No arquivo de configuração você pode criar quantas máquinas querer)

Link para o comentário
Compartilhar em outros sites

Tem um link em baixo do vídeo que funfa...

 

Ele é um plugin de máquinas multibloco. Você pode comprar um livro (que é um plano de construção)

No livro você vai ter as informações dos materiais nescessários para construir a máquina.

Ai é só clicar em um bloco de ferro com os materiais que a construção irá começar...

Ai nas outras páginas do livro você pode ver o que sua máquina pode fazer...

(No arquivo de configuração você pode criar quantas máquinas querer)

Quer ser dono do meu sv nao ;-; seu dlç

Link para o comentário
Compartilhar em outros sites

Eai (mano) '-'

 

Adiciona suporte a spawners...

 

Colocar spawner dentro da máquina gera itens especiais (configurável)

Spawner de iron golem gera um ferro (com tag especial pra vender de forma diferente no shop)

 

Dá suporte a encantamento nas máquinas também

 

Acabaria com o problema dos spawners

Link para o comentário
Compartilhar em outros sites

Eai (mano) '-'

 

Adiciona suporte a spawners...

 

Colocar spawner dentro da máquina gera itens especiais (configurável)

Spawner de iron golem gera um ferro (com tag especial pra vender de forma diferente no shop)

 

Dá suporte a encantamento nas máquinas também

 

Acabaria com o problema dos spawners

 

To pensando em um modo de criar configurações in-game para dar suporte a livros...

 

Ou criar um programinha simples para criar as configurações...

Link para o comentário
Compartilhar em outros sites

Em breve: (maquina solar) 

  "solar":
    price: 10000
    design:
      wall: iron_block
      separator: lapis_block
    build:
      stone: 64
      iron_block: 32
      lapis_block: 9
    produces:
      blaze_rod: 600
      diamond: 1000
    fuels:
      night: 100
      day: 500

Em breve máquina de spawner

 

Source

http://github.com/Manolo8/simplemachines

Link para o comentário
Compartilhar em outros sites

 

(Quem usou algum FIX não use a versão 1.3, peça pra mim o FIX antes!,

não tenho culpa de vocês usar plugin bugado... '-')

nem senti a indireta não hihihihi

 

 

uehuehueheuhuehe

Amanhã eu faço o bagui pra ti...

Link para o comentário
Compartilhar em outros sites

Nova versão adicionada!

 

Download https://mega.nz/#!rlwHTZJb!E4oM1LtfPnCi9oFJUJ4FEKQN2-fhO1TpUE8QoV5GcgI

 

1.4

1. Adicionado itens customizáveis (com lore, com encantamento (op, se você quizer))

(Pode usar combustíveis editados também, pra máquinas diferenciadas...)

Ex:

 
custom_items:
  my_custom_sword:
    type: diamond_sword
    display: "&bDiamond Sword"
    enchantments:
      sharpness: 10
      unbreaking: 3
    lore:
      - &bVery strong sword
      - &dBe careful!
  my_custom_fuel:
    type: coal
    display: "&dSUPER COAL"
    lore:
      - &dThis is a super coal!
      - &dUse in an custom machine!

 
Exemplo de máquina:
  "custom_machine":
    type: fuel
    price: 4000
    design:
      #o design nao suporta itens customizaveis!
      wall: gold_block
      separator: obsidian
    build:
      diamond_block: 64
    produces:
      my_custom_sword: 4000
    fuels:
      my_custom_fuel:
        burn: 8000
        speed: 5

Ao invéis de colocar nos combustíveis, por exemplo, iron_ore, colocoque my_custom_sword que é gg  :)

Editado por Manolo8
Link para o comentário
Compartilhar em outros sites

Mano eu tive uma ideia pra tu fazer nesse pl incrivel que vai deixar ele mais incrivel, porque você não coloca uma nova atualização com a maquina ne normal mais ai você retira todos os baus e coloca pra quando você clicar em qualquer bloco da maquina abrir um gui com um bau que abre um inventario aonde você coloca os combustivel e colocar outro bau logo do lado dentro do gui que abre o lugar pra onde vai os drops e pra maquinas solares e lunares você tira o bau e coloca uma informação de tipo vidro vermelho e porque esta funcionando a base da luz e vidro azul porque esta funcionando a base da noite intendeu, dai você coloca tbm pra você configurar se vai querer que a maquina tenha lava e agua dentro podendo desativar e sair a agua e a lava e coloca tbm pra poder escolher quantos blocos tera na construção da maquina podendo configurar apenas um bloco funcionara como maquina e coloca tambem pra tu comprar um bloco que quando você coloca ja vira maquina substituindo os livros.

Link para o comentário
Compartilhar em outros sites

Eu estava pensando em fazer uma variação desse plugin, com a diferença que seria em GUI...

(Você teria que comprar a máquina e colocar em algum lugar do mundo, após isso, você poderia acessar ela por GUI)

 

Em relação ao tamanho da máquina customizável, daria de fazer, mas aí teria que remover os baus (Seria apenas por gui, por isso que seria uma variação, algumas pessoas curtiram a ideia de ter os baús)...

 

Teria alguns prós: Teria mais eficiência, pois, não precisaria mexer com os blocos no mundo... E as máquinas também poderiam operar offline...

 

Um contra que eu imaginei: Não daria de stackar as máquinas, como dá de fazer agora...

(Na real daria, mas teria que ter uma GUI para informar a saída da máquina... Isso poderia ser aproveitado de mais alguma forma... Criar um "depósito", onde poderia colocar todas as saídas para esse depósito...)

 

Na operação offline, teria duas maneiras:

1º Contaria o TEMPO em que a máquina ficou offline e sempre que um jogador abrir a máquina ele calcula o tempo real, e processa as informações (não sei explicar, mas funcionaria)

2º Ou, como as máquinas tem um inventário, alguma hora iria lotar (paras as máquinas solares/lunares seria a unica forma), e as outras, quando o combustível acabar...

 

A segunda opção seria mais fácil por conta do GUI, mas se o servidor ficasse offline, as máquinas não funcionariam (O que não seria um problema, né '-')

 

O problema, é que, como pode ver, é um sistema um pouco complexo, e não sei se muita gente usaria... Mas em fim, o que acha?

Link para o comentário
Compartilhar em outros sites

 

OBS: Pra quem já usa o plugin e já tem máquinas no banco de dados, rode o plugin, (Será gerado uma nova pasta config) e então pegue sua oldConfig.yml e adicione as máquinas para a nova config.yml (Adicione o path: nomedamaquina.type: fuel (esse último não precisa))

 

SimpleMachines

 

Vídeos

Meu

https://www.youtube.com/watch?v=PGPdguvbGB0

Gringo

https://www.youtube.com/watch?v=X9Pl27xRzM4

 

V 1.4

 

Agora vem com 4 tipos de máquinas configuradas! (Você pode configurar quantas quiser)

Há dois estilo de máquinas: Máquina que usa apenas combustíveis e máquinas que usam combustíveis e

um ingrediente (carvão + minério de ouro = x barras de ouro...)

 

config.yml:

VERSION: 1.1
#Caso voce remova algum plano de construcao
#Ative isso para que as maquinas sejam removidas
#Do sistema.
REMOVE_MACHINE_WRONG: false
Database:
  #types: [SQLITE],[MYSQL]
  TYPE: SQLITE
  MYSQL:
    HOST: localhost
    USERNAME: root
    PASSWORD: root
    DB: arenax1
machines:
#Obs: Os valores não podem ser maior que o tamanho máximo da stack
#Se for maior, divida o valor total pelo tamanho da stack
#Obs: 128 diamantes =
#diamond: 64
#diamond: 64
#e não diamond: 128
#Obs2: 32 eggs (ovo):
#egg: 16
#egg: 16
  "ouro":
    type: fuel
    price: 4000
    design:
      wall: gold_block
      separator: obsidian
    build:
      diamond: 32
      obsidian: 8
      gold_block: 15
      iron_ingot: 8
    produces:
      gold_ingot: 400
    fuels:
      coal:
        burn: 800
        speed: 1.5
      coal_block:
        burn: 7200
        speed: 2.5
      wood:
        burn: 150
        speed: 0.8
  "esqueleto":
    type: fuel
    price: 4000
    design:
      wall: mossy_cobblestone
      separator: iron_block
    build:
      stone: 64
      iron_block: 20
    produces:
      bone: 50
      arrow: 50
    fuels:
      coal:
        burn: 800
        speed: 1.5
      coal_block:
        burn: 7200
        speed: 2.5
      wood:
        burn: 150
        speed: 0.8
  "blaze":
    type: fuel
    price: 4000
    design:
      wall: netherrack
      separator: gold_block
    build:
      stone: 64
      gold_block: 32
      netherrack: 64
    produces:
      blaze_rod: 600
    fuels:
      coal:
        burn: 800
        speed: 1.5
      coal_block:
        burn: 7200
        speed: 2.5
      wood:
        burn: 150
        speed: 0.8
  "macerador":
    type: ingredient
    price: 6000
    design:
      wall: cobblestone
      separator: iron_block
    build:
      stone: 64
      dirt: 64
      iron_ingot: 32
      diamond: 16
      redstone: 64
    produces:
      iron_ingot:
        quantity: 2
        with: iron_ore
        fuel: 200
      gold_ingot:
        quantity: 2
        with: gold_ore
        fuel: 200
      diamond:
        quantity: 4
        with: diamond_ore
        fuel: 800
      emerald:
        quantity: 3
        with: emerald_ore
        fuel: 800
      quartz:
        quantity: 8
        with: quartz_ore
        fuel: 300
    fuels:
      coal:
        burn: 800
        speed: 0.8
      coal_block:
        burn: 7200
        speed: 0.8
      wood:
        burn: 150
        speed: 0.6 

 

BOOK.txt

#Renomeie esse arquivo para book.txt para torna-lo padrão!
#Para adicionar a tradução de minérios:
#[material-NOME]
#Nome customizável
#[end]

[material-gold_ore]
Minério de ouro
[end]

[material-diamond]
Diamante
[end]

[material-arrow]
Flexa
[end]

[material-bone]
Osso
[end]

[material-coal]
Carvão
[end]

[material-diamond_ore]
Minério de diamante
[end]

#Tudo que está abaixo não pode ser removido, só alterado
[formatter-cost]
&c-> {material} {quantity}
[end]

[formatter-production_fuel]
&c->{material}
&cA cada {ticks} ticks
[end]

[formatter-production_ingredient]
&c->{material}
&cCom: {with}
&cA cada {ticks} ticks
&a-------------------
[end]

[formatter-fuel]
&c-> {material} {speed}x
&bQueima por {ticks}
&a-------------------
[end]

[lore-x]
&aSimpleMachines
{cost}
[end]

[page-0]
&d&l--{name}--
&aCusto do livro:
{cost}
&aClique em um bloco de
ferro para iniciar a
construção da máquina!
[end]

[page-1]
&a&l----Produção:----
{production}&aVá para a próxima
página para ver os
combustíveis!
[end]

[page-2]
&a&l--Combustíveis---
{fuel}
[end]

[page-3]
FIM
[end] 

 

DOWNLOAD: 1.0: https://mega.nz/#!35pzzTyL!U36KA9cNO_hsPiitJccCeebkNsjJT6WXvR_wISohPS8

Download: 1.01 http://www.mediafire.com/file/y97gpd05a5hjhj2/SimpleMachines-1.01-SNAPSHOT.jar

Download: 1.1 http://www.mediafire.com/file/1p37lk194u3xc4r/SimpleMachines-1.1-SNAPSHOT.jar

Download 1.2 https://mega.nz/#!ugwAyRxT!w6Ng-oWf56ghq6MDAshbKHOSMGdqVyipBCcskoLoj0Y

Download 1.3 https://mega.nz/#!vs5VHTya!N_GkY2LEKUbe-1HF71rF_wKg71v_vmNLaMTD6PlnfN0

Download 1.4 https://mega.nz/#!rlwHTZJb!E4oM1LtfPnCi9oFJUJ4FEKQN2-fhO1TpUE8QoV5GcgI

 

Se tiver erros me AVISEM! Please, espero que gostem :)

(Quem usou algum FIX não use a versão 1.3, peça pra mim o FIX antes!,

não tenho culpa de vocês usar plugin bugado... '-')

 

CHANGELOD

1.01

____

UPDATE:

1. Consertado um bug em que a máquina não era removida do banco de dados quando se tornava inválida

 

2. Agora é salvo na memória um identificador para o sistema saber se há maquinas na chunk, sem precisar fazer uma requisição sql no

banco de dados para saber sobre essa informação (Performance melhorada no carregamento de chunks)

 

1.1

1. Consertado alguns bugs

2. Agora é possível editar os livros

(Se você usou a versão 1.0, você deve remover a pasta e a tabela no banco de dados...)

 

1.2

1. Performance melhorada

2. Adicionado máquinas que usam ingredientes

 

1.3

1. Adicionado máquinas solares

2. (Melhorado uns códigos internos, mas sem modificação na performance)

 

1.4

1. Adicionado itens customizáveis (com lore, com encantamento (op, se você quizer))

(Pode usar combustíveis editados também, pra máquinas diferenciadas...)

Ex:

custom_items:
  my_custom_sword:
    type: diamond_sword
    display: "&bDiamond Sword"
    enchantments:
      sharpness: 10
      unbreaking: 3
    lore:
      - &bVery strong sword
      - &dBe careful!
  my_custom_fuel:
    type: coal
    display: "&dSUPER COAL"
    lore:
      - &dThis is a super coal!
      - &dUse in an custom machine!

Ao invéis de colocar nos combustíveis, por exemplo, iron_ore, colocoque my_custom_sword que é gg :)

 

Bom, o plugin é bom, mas a configuração dele é bem chatinha por conta de que está em inglês, tem muito mais coisa do que plugins normais,requer bastante coisa pra configurar(praticamente qualquer coisa pode fazer o plugin bugar)

O que eu acho que você deveria fazer: Mudar a linguagem do plugin para português( Ao invés de fuel, combustivel,ao invés de type, tipo, e etc)

Link para o comentário
Compartilhar em outros sites

O que vocês acham?

 

https://youtu.be/AAAzQB2ps4M

  "DiamondCollector":
    type: collector
    price: 10000
    design:
      wall: stone
      separator: iron_block
    build:
      stone: 64
      iron_block: 32
      lapis_block: 9
    collect:
      - pumpkin
      - melon
      - cactus
      - sugar
      - wheat
      - carrot
      - potato
    range:
      xz: 10
      y: 5
    fuels:
      coal:
        wood:
          burn: 12000
          efficiency: 0.8
        coal:
          burn: 160000
          efficiency: 1
Link para o comentário
Compartilhar em outros sites

ANÁLISE DE INATIVIDADE
 

Este tópico foi automaticamente arquivado devido à inatividade. Para manter a organização e fluidez das discussões na comunidade, tópicos que permanecem sem novas interações por um período prolongado são fechados automaticamente.
 

Se houver interesse em retomar o conteúdo, sinta-se à vontade para criar um novo tópico ou entre em contato com a equipe da comunidade para reabrir este tópico.


Equipe de Moderação
Gamer's Board
Link para o comentário
Compartilhar em outros sites

Visitante
Este tópico está impedido de receber novos posts.
×
×
  • Criar Novo...